What is the EMS method

The EMS method was developed to rehabilitate the musculoskeletal system after various injuries. The device uses electrical muscle stimulation (EMS) technology to facilitate muscle training and improve muscle performance, strengthening the stimulated muscle and increasing its resistance to fatigue.

Muscle strains, microtrauma of joints, tendons and ligaments — all of this can be successfully treated with electrostimulation, because a directed discharge of electric current accelerates regeneration.

How does an EMS device work? Stimulation is based on the electrical conductivity of nerves and muscles. The natural irritants of muscles are the signals produced by nerve cells. Electrostimulation models the muscle excitation process, except that the signal comes not from nerve cells, but from a special electronic device.

The person puts on a special suit equipped with sensors. The device generates a signal that is identical to the impulse with which a person's brain tells the muscles to contract and relax. The muscles pick up this impulse and carry out the command. The sensations during training may at first feel unusual, because tissue activity increases without a direct brain command.

Muscle contraction in response to stimulation of the motor nerves is identical to natural movement. As a result, fitness and muscle definition are actively restored, muscles are strengthened, fatigue is relieved and toxins are flushed out.

A session consists of three parts

  • Warm-up — a set of cardio exercises.
  • Main strength part. It differs in the depth of the impulses and the nature of the delivery. Discharges are delivered with pauses, alternating between work and rest. Exercises are performed at the moment of muscle contraction under the action of electrostimulation. This allows maximum benefit to be drawn from every movement.
  • Closing part — a lymphatic drainage massage that activates the mechanism for removing metabolic waste and promotes faster recovery of the body.
